Job DetailsJob Location: Hanania Chevrolet - St Augustine, FL 32086Job Summary: We are looking for an experienced and highly motivated Collision Center Estimator to join our team. The ideal candidate will work directly with customers and insurance companies to estimate the cost of repairs and ensure timely completion of repairs. This role requires strong communication skills, technical knowledge of auto body repairs, and the ability to navigate insurance estimating processes and protocols.   Supervisory Responsibilities: None   Duties & Responsibilities: Greet and assist customers in the estimation process, provide support with insurance claims, and prepare detailed estimates and photos for submission and approval. Demonstrate in-depth knowledge of major Insurance Direct Repair Program (DRP) protocols, and upload estimates and images that meet DRP standards. Maintain contact with customers throughout the repair process, providing updates on the status of their vehicle and ensuring a positive customer experience. Prepare final invoices that align with the approved estimates, ensuring accurate and efficient billing processes. Contact the vehicle owner ahead of time to notify them when their vehicle will be ready for pickup, keeping them informed of the timeline for completion. Work with the shop and technicians to ensure quality control throughout the repair process and ensure that repairs meet customer and manufacturer standards.
